ユーザーコマンド nice(1)
【名前】
nice - コマンドを変更されたスケジューリング優先順位で実行
【形式】
/usr/bin/nice [-increment | -n increment] command [argument
...]
/usr/xpg4/bin/nice [-increment | -n increment] command
[argument ...]
[csh 組み込みコマンド]
nice [-increment | +increment] [command]
【機能説明】
nice ユーティリティは、異なるシステムのスケジューリング優 先
順 位で動作するように command を実行します。priocntl(1) コマ
ンドは、スケジューラ機能とのより汎用的なインタフェースです。
起動するプロセス (通常は、ユーザーのシェル) は、nice コマ ン
ドをサポートするスケジューリングクラスで実行されていなければ
なりません。
C シェル ( csh(1) 参照 ) を使用している場合、コマンドのフ ル
パス名を指定する必要があります。指定しないと、csh 組み込みコ
マンドの nice が実行されます。以下の「 csh 組み込みコマン ド
」の項を参照。
[/usr/bin/nice]
nice が引数のあるコマンドを実行する場合、デフォルトのシェ ル
/usr/bin/sh が使われます ( sh(1) 参照 ) 。
[/usr/xpg4/bin/nice]
nice が引数のあるコマンドを実行する場合、/usr/xpg4/bin/sh が
使われます ( ksh(1) 参照 ) 。
[csh 組み込みコマンド]
nice という csh の組み込みコマンドもあります。こちらの 動 作
は、ここで説明した nice とは異なります。詳しくは csh(1) を参
照してください。
【オプション】
以下のオプションを指定できます。
-increment | -n increment は正または負の 10 進整数です。この
オプションは、ユーティリティバージョンの実行
時に、nice() 関数に increment オプション引数
( 数値) を指定して呼び出した場合と同じ効果を
発揮します。nice(2) を参照して く だ さ い。
nice() の エ ラー(EINVAL 以外) は無視されま
す。このオプションを指定しない場合、増 分 は
10 で あ ると想定されます。スーパーユーザー
は、たとえば --10 のように、負数の increment
を使用することにより、通常よりも高い優先順位
でコマンドを実行することができます。特権を持
たないユーザーが負数の増分値を指定した場合は
無視されます。
【オペランド】
以下のオペランドを指定できます。
command 呼び出すコマンドの名前。command に組み込みコ
マ ンド ( shell_builtins(1) を参照) を指定し
た場合、処理の結果は保証されません。
argument command を呼び出す際に引数として与える 文 字
列。
【環境】
nice の実行に影響を与える環境変数 LC_CTYPE 、LC_MESSAGES 、
NLSPATH についての詳細は、environ(5) を参照してください。
【終了ステータス】
command で指定したコマンドが呼び出された場合、そのコマンドの
終了ステータスが nice の終了ステータスとなります。呼び出され
なかった場合には、nice は以下の終了ステータスを返します。
1-125 エラーが発生した
126 コマンドは見つかったが呼び出すことがで き な
かった
127 コマンドが見つからなかった。
【属性】
次の属性については attributes(5) のマニュアルページを参照 し
てください。
[/usr/bin/nice]
____________________________________________________________
| 属性タイプ | 属性値 |
|_____________________________|_____________________________|
| 使用条件 | SUNWcsu |
|_____________________________|_____________________________|
| CSI | 対応済み |
|_____________________________|_____________________________|
[/usr/xpg4/bin/nice]
____________________________________________________________
| 属性タイプ | 属性値 |
|_____________________________|_____________________________|
| 使用条件 | SUNWxcu4 |
|_____________________________|_____________________________|
| CSI | 対応済み |
|_____________________________|_____________________________|
| インタフェースの安定性 | 標準 |
|_____________________________|_____________________________|
【関連項目】
csh(1), ksh(1), nohup(1), priocntl(1), sh(1),
shell_builtins(1), nice(2), attributes(5), environ(5),
XPG4(5)
|
|